Multimodal Polymers with Supported Catalysts Design and Production /

This book provides an overview of polyolefine production, including several recent breakthrough innovations in the fields of catalysis, process technology, and materials design. Πίνακας περιεχομένων:
  • Chapter 1. Review on recent developments in supported polyolefin catalysts
  • Chapter 2. Support Designed for Polymerization Processes
  • Chapter 3. Fragmentation, Particle Growth and Single Particle Modelling
  • Chapter 4. Polymerization Kinetics and the Effect of Reactor Residence Time on Polymer Microstructure
  • Chapter 5. Industrial Multi-modal Processes
  • Chapter 6. Multimodal Polypropylenes: The close interplay between catalysts, processes and polymer design
  • Chapter 7. Bimodal Polyethylene:Controlling polymer properties by molecular design.
